Surp Tateos and Surp Partoğomeos Armenian Church
audio narration:
https://dijitalistanbul.org/dijitalistanbulaudio/94876.mp3
construction year:
1846
location:
Fatih, İstanbul
ordered by:
Patrarch Madteos II Çuhacıyan
architect:
Unknown
Changes After Construction:
The foundation of the church was laid in 1846.
The building was renovated in 1969; the renovation was carried out with the support of the Tateos Ajderhanyan couple and several benefactors.
Prominent Features:
The church belongs to the Armenian Patriarchate of Turkey.
The building is dedicated to the Apostles Surp Tateos and Surp Partoğomeos.
The building is a church belonging to the Armenian Apostolic tradition.
It is stated that benefactors are buried in the church courtyard and that their names and dates have been recorded.
